I work with individuals, couples, and families assisting them to better communicate feelings which can lead to reducing stress and anger in the home.
Much of my practice consists of assisting Couples to becoming more emotionally connected and intimately engaged in their relationship.
I work in helping to identify stressors which heighten anxiety and teach techniques to reduce stress and anxiety.
Another passion is to match others with their passion in life. I look at one's whole life including self, family, leisure, income responsibilities, gifts and interests. I see career as an integral part of one's whole life.

About My Practice
I have been counseling others for over fifteen years and have helped hundreds of clients in finding and fulfilling their inner passions. In the process of clients discovering their passions many have rediscovered their own natural gifts and abilities. Many clients have found that by recognizing their transferable skill sets, transitioning into a new career is much more accessible than they once thought.
I can identify with my clients
As one who has gone through this career transitioning process myself, I understand some of the challenges clients face. I am a former public school educator. I have served as a youth director and volunteer coordinator for non-profit organizations where I have recruited and trained over 100 volunteers to serve locally and aboard. I have worked with clients in fields of higher education, construction management, health care, engineering, advertising, and small business development and managment. I returned to graduate school to complete my masters degree in the clinical counseling field and opened my private practice, Centerline Counseling in 2007. In 2010 I co-founded Ruxton Counseling Center in Towson, Maryland .
